Comedian Nate Bargatze will be making his debut as the host of the Emmy Awards, which will be broadcast live on CBS. For those who are unable to watch the event on TV, Paramount+ subscribers with Showtime can stream the show live as well. The Emmy Awards honor the best in television, with awards given out in various categories to recognize outstanding performances and productions. From dramas to comedies, reality shows to documentaries, the Emmys celebrate the diverse and talented individuals who work in the television industry.
